Davis, Mathis Reappointed to Georgia Cotton Commission Board
In late June, the Commodity Commission Ex Officio Committee met to make appointments to the Georgia Cotton Commission (GCC) Board of Directors. GCC Chairman Bart Davis, a cotton, peanut, corn and cattle farmer from Doerun, Ga. was reappointed to another term on the board. USDA Forecasts an Increasing Trade Deficit in 2025
The USDA forecasted the agricultural trade deficit to increase sharply to a record $42.5 billion in the coming fiscal year. That compares to $30.5 billion this fiscal year, which ends September 30.
